2-Propanol

2-Propanol (Isopropyl alcohol, Isopropanol, IPA) is a colorless solvent and is the simplest example of a secondary alcohol. It is moderately polar and has a boiling point of 82 °C. 2-Propanol dissolves a wide range of non-polar compounds and it evaporates quickly. Thus, it is used widely as a cleaning fluid, especially for dissolving oils. Suitable for LC-MS and cleaning LC-MS systems.

Formula: (CH₃)₂CHOH
MW: 60.1 g/mol
Boiling Pt: 77…83 °C (1.013 hPa)
Melting Pt: –90 °C
Density: 0.784…0.786 g/cm³ (20 °C) (lit.)
Flash Pt: 12 °C
Storage Temperature: Ambient
MDL Number: MFCD00011674
CAS Number: 67-63-0
EINECS: 200-661-7
UN: 1219
ADR: 3 II
Merck Index: 13,05228
